New York: Farrar, Straus & Cudahy, 1957. Book. Very Good. Hardcover. 1st Edition. Stated first edition. Boards are straight, binding is tight and tips are pointed. Endpaper tanning, a nick and fold or two here and there on the text block, slight mustiness but no markings internally and appears unread. DJ has some minor staining and slight nicks and loss at edges especially spine ends but it is not price clipped. Looks thoughtful in a shiny mylar dust protector. Packaging suitable for wrapping..
